Output 2663266eafaf5b8dba6daa888a7560587221e4bea13c6599883a3d95da2adf85:0

value
3419356
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63dbcecb85174effe6b8bf1afa5e081598755f90 OP_EQUALVERIFY OP_CHECKSIG
address
1A71DWFqqmpE5vPApY5rzkDLVjkGRhcTg8
transaction
2663266eafaf5b8dba6daa888a7560587221e4bea13c6599883a3d95da2adf85
confirmations
408470
spent
true